Reingjerdnesset
Reingjerdnesset is a headland in Båtsfjord, Finnmark and has an elevation of 40 metres. Reingjerdnesset is situated nearby to the locality Jonjok.| Tap on a place to explore it |

Syltefjorden
Hamlet
Syltefjorden or Oardovuonna is a fjord in Båtsfjord Municipality in Finnmark county, Norway. The 16-kilometre long fjord flows from the river Syltefjordelva on the large Varanger Peninsula into the Barents Sea. Syltefjorden is situated 9 km northeast of Reingjerdnesset.
